About the Role

The Accountant will be primarily focused on the annual financial close process, preparation and review of statutory accounts and other compliance obligations. You will be required to work on various accounting projects and supplementary works as part of the continuous improvement of the statutory compliance process.

  • Preparation of extended trial balance for annual statutory accounts for international entities.
  • Preparation and review of statutory financial statements for international entities.

  • Preparation of flux analysis and overall understanding of International entities.

  • Preparation of journal entries, review general ledger accounts and prepare reconciliations in accordance with US GAAP/IFRS.

  • Completion of statutory quarterly and annual financial close processes.
  • Liaise with audit teams and other advisors to ensure timely and accurate completion of all statutory obligations for several international entities.
  • Preparation of requested items for external providers including required schedules and support packs for annual compliance.
  • Collaborate with internal stakeholders to develop and continually improve processes and systems for both financial and statutory reporting.
  • Work cross-functionally internally, specifically with internal tax, legal and corp accounting teams.
  • Preparation of Statistical returns for several international entities.
  • Participation in accounting projects to bring continuous improvement to statutory compliance.

Our Approach to Flexible Work

With Flex Work, we're combining the best of both worlds: in-person time and remote. Our approach enables our teams to deepen connections, maintain a strong community, and do their best work. We know that flexibility can take shape in many ways, so rather than a number of required days in-office each week, we simply spend at least half (50%) of our time each quarter in the office or in the field with our customers, prospects, and partners (depending on role). This means you'll have the freedom to create a flexible schedule that caters to your business, team, and personal needs, while being intentional to make the most of time spent together. Those in our remote "home office" roles also have the opportunity to come together in our offices for important moments that matter.
